Protect Yourself


What I've learned. What I'm doing to survive this battle...


  • Never underestimate anything!
  • Never discount even the most outrageous of behaviors.
  • Pin/Code/Password access to your phone. It is a pain to have to enter the pin everytime (I have mine set to lock at 1 minute), but it is a must.
  • DOCUMENT EVERYTHING!!! Use a "note" app (I have the iphone, so I use Notes *which automatically saves to icloud. Dropbox can be used as well) Notes (are datestamped automatically) just type in enough detail to help u remember.
  • Other options for documenting
  • voice recorder on phone. Always keep your ringer on silent so he isn't alerted to you communicating with others.
  • photos (whenever possible, even if you think its irrational in the moment, take that picture!) Again, make sure your shutter press on phone is silent.
  • Video on your phone. This is a tough one because it takes up so much space. YOu will need to have the ability to upload to icloud or Dropbox (do this automatically in setttings) and then when you're sure of it's upload, back your data up to an external hardrive (I have the litte WD passport. It's discrete and portable.
  • -A regular digital camera works fine as well, as long as its something that he wouldn't suspect as out of the norm to be setting around.
  • -Watch for patterned behaviors. For me, I began to notice things every time I took a bath or shower. Things like: tv volume reduced to near mute; I would hear his recliner opening or closing; doors opening and closing; would take the dog out even if she had just beeen out, landscape lighting suddenly stopped working correctly on the pathway just outside bath. This list goes on and on, but DONT UNDERESTIMATE IT!!!
